Haikou Airport Transfers

Haikou Meilan International Airport

Arriving at Haikou Meilan International Airport is smooth and well organised. Clear signs and official transport options make it easy to reach the city.

🚌 Airport Shuttle Bus

  • Fare: Around ¥20
  • Travel time: 40–60 minutes
  • Runs from early morning until late night
  • Best for budget travelers who want a direct ride

🚌 Public City Bus

  • Fare: ¥2–6
  • Travel time: 60 minutes or more
  • Daytime and evening service
  • Best for light travelers, can be crowded at peak hours

🚄 Airport Train Connection

  • Fare: ¥10–20
  • Travel time: 10–20 minutes to Haikou East Station
  • Fast and comfortable if your hotel is near a station

🚖 Taxi

  • City center: ¥40–60
  • Nearby areas: ¥20–30
  • Travel time: 25–40 minutes
  • Tip: Show your hotel name in Chinese

🚗 Hotel Transfer or Private Car

  • Cost: Free or paid, depending on hotel
  • Travel time: 30–40 minutes
  • Tip: Check availability with your hotel in advance

Haikou Urban Rail and High-Speed Train

Haikou High-Speed Train

Haikou does not have a subway-style metro system. Instead, the city uses urban rail services and the Hainan Island high-speed railway to connect the airport, major stations, and nearby cities. The trains are clean, air-conditioned, and easy to use, making them a convenient option for first-time visitors, especially if your hotel is near a railway station.

🛤️ Key Stations in Haikou

Some of the most useful railway stations for travelers include:

Haikou East Railway Station

  • Main high-speed rail hub in the city
  • Convenient for travel to Sanya, Wenchang, and other cities in Hainan

Haikou Meilan International Airport

  • Direct railway access inside the airport
  • Easy connection between the airport and city stations

Haikou Railway Station

  • Serves some long-distance and cross-strait routes
  • Useful for ferry-linked rail travel to mainland China

If your accommodation is close to any of these stations, the train can save time and avoid road traffic.

⏱️ Operating Hours and Frequency

  • Trains generally run from early morning until late evening
  • Frequency varies by route, usually every 10 to 20 minutes for busy sections
  • Schedules may change slightly on public holidays

You usually won’t need to wait long, especially during the day.

💳 Tickets and Payment

  • Short trips within Haikou: around ¥10–20
  • Intercity trips within Hainan: higher, based on destination
  • Buy tickets at station counters, ticket machines, or official railway apps
  • Payment accepted: cash (CNY), Alipay, WeChat Pay

⚠️ Things to Note

  • This is not a full metro network, so stations are spaced farther apart than subways in larger cities
  • You may need a short taxi or bus ride from the station to your hotel
  • Last trains usually run before midnight, so late-night travel may require a taxi

Public Buses in Haikou

Public Buses in Haikou

Taking the public bus is one of the easiest and cheapest ways to explore Haikou. If you want to save money and experience the city like a local, the bus is a good choice.

🚍 Routes and Fare

Haikou’s bus network covers most parts of the city, including:

  • Downtown Haikou – shopping areas, local markets
  • Haikou East Railway Station – for high-speed train connections
  • Haikou Meilan Airport – airport buses available
  • Tourist spots – Evergreen Park, Arcaded Streets, Hainan Museum
  • Local neighborhoods and universities

Standard Fare

  • Most routes cost ¥1 to ¥2 per ride (around PHP 8–15)
  • Express or longer-distance routes may cost up to ¥5 (about PHP 35)

You can check the route number and destination at the bus stop sign. Bus stops usually show route maps and schedules.

💳 How to Pay for the Bus

You have a few ways to pay:

  • Cash: Exact change only. Drivers do not give change
  • Transportation card (Hainan Tong Card): Tap when boarding
  • Mobile payment: Alipay or WeChat Pay on supported buses

Sightseeing Buses in Haikou

Sightseeing Buses in Haikou

If you’re visiting Haikou for the first time, the sightseeing bus is an easy and relaxed way to see the main attractions without planning every stop.

🗺️ How It Works

These hop-on hop-off buses follow a fixed route that covers many of Haikou’s most popular tourist spots. You can get off at any stop, explore, and then hop back on the next bus using the same ticket.

  • Just one ticket for unlimited rides that day
  • Great way to move around if you’re not familiar with the area
  • Buses come with recorded guides or signage in Chinese (some may have English audio or printed maps)

⏱️ Route and Duration

  • Full loop: about 60–70 minutes
  • Stops near Evergreen Park, Arcaded Streets, Century Bridge, Holiday Beach, and Hainan Museum
  • Pick-up points in downtown areas and near large hotels
Routes, stops, and operating hours may change by season or local arrangements. Check the latest information at the ticket counter or official city tourism platforms before boarding.

🌃 Night Sightseeing Tour

Haikou also has open-top night buses that take you around the city after dark. These are perfect if you want to enjoy the lights, bridges, and coastal views in a calm setting.

  • Night tours usually take around 45 to 50 minutes
  • Great way to cool down and enjoy the breeze after a warm day
  • Some routes may pass through Haikou Bay, Century Park, and lit-up shopping areas

🎟️ Ticket Info

  • Sold near boarding points or via Alipay and WeChat
  • Day and night tours require separate tickets
  • Prices are affordable, especially for families or groups

Hotel Free Shuttle Bus in Haikou

Shuttle Bus in Haikou

Some large hotels and resorts in Haikou offer free shuttle buses for guests, usually connecting the airport, nearby shopping areas, railway stations, and selected attractions. Availability and routes vary by hotel, so it’s best to check with the hotel in advance.

🏨 Common Hotels with Shuttle Buses

Hotels such as The Ritz-Carlton Haikou, Mission Hills Resort, and Wyndham Garden Haikou are known to provide shuttle services. Pick-up points are usually located near the hotel lobby or main entrance.

🟢 Key Things to Know

  • Shuttle buses are usually free for hotel guests
  • Some hotels may allow non-guests to ride if seats are available, but this is not guaranteed
  • Always check with hotel staff first before boarding
  • Routes commonly include shopping areas, parks, resorts, and transport hubs
  • Shuttle frequency varies by hotel and time of day, especially during busy hours

📍 Good For

  • Travelers with luggage
  • Visitors staying in resort or hotel areas
  • Anyone looking for a convenient ride to nearby transport hubs or attractions

Taxis and Ride-Hailing in Haikou

Haikou Taxi

Taking a taxi in Haikou is a simple and comfortable way to get around, especially if you are carrying luggage, arriving late at night, or traveling with a group. It is faster than public transport and easy to use for visitors.

💰 Haikou Taxi Fare Guide

There are two common options: regular street taxis and ride-hailing through apps like Didi.

1. Standard Taxis (Blue or Yellow Cars)

  • Base fare: ¥10 for the first 3 kilometers (around PHP 80)
  • After 3 kilometers: ¥2 per kilometer
  • Waiting time: ¥1 every few minutes if the car is not moving
  • Luggage: Usually free unless you have oversized bags that need the trunk

2. Didi Ride-Hailing App

  • Works like Grab
  • You can choose from regular, comfort, or carpool rides
  • Prices may be slightly higher during busy times
  • You can use the app in English and pay with card or mobile wallets

3. Extra Charges

  • Some trips starting from the airport or train station may include an extra charge of ¥5 to ¥10
  • Check the estimated fare before you ride, especially during peak hours

🚖 How to Get a Taxi in Haikou

  • Hail one on the street by raising your hand
  • Go to a taxi stand near malls, hotels, or stations
  • Use the Didi app to book a ride without needing to speak Chinese

Tip: Download the Didi app before your trip. Choose English in the settings and link your card or Alipay account for easy payment.

Always ensure the meter is turned on. Avoid accepting rides from unofficial drivers inside the terminal.

✅ When to Take a Taxi

  • When public buses are not running or hard to find
  • If you have lots of luggage or are tired
  • When traveling with two or more people
  • To reach places far from the city center or tourist areas

Exploring Haikou on Foot

Evergreen Garden

Haikou is a relaxed and walkable city, especially around the old town, parks, and coastal areas. Many attractions are close together, making walking a budget-friendly way to enjoy the scenery, take photos, and discover local snacks at your own pace.

🏛️ Suggested Walking Routes in Haikou

1. Old Town Culture Walk (2 to 3 hours)

Route: Qilou Old Street → Zhongshan Road → Arcade Streets → Haikou Clock Tower → People’s Park
Tip: Look for the unique colonial-style buildings along Qilou Street. Try local coconut desserts or rice cakes at small shops nearby.

2. Coastal and Nature Walk (2 to 3 hours)

Route: Evergreen Park → Century Bridge (walkable area) → Haikou Bay → Holiday Beach
Tip: Go in the late afternoon for cooler weather and sunset views. Street vendors often sell cold drinks and snacks near the beach area.

3. History and Market Walk (3 to 4 hours)

Route: Hainan Museum → Wugong Temple (Five Officials Temple) → Haikou Arcade Street Market → Renmin Avenue
Tip: Visit early in the morning or after 4 PM to avoid strong heat. Bring a small fan or umbrella for shade. Local markets are great for pasalubong shopping.

Haikou can be hot and humid, especially from April to October. Walk early in the morning or after 4 PM for better comfort.

Traveling from Haikou to Other Cities

One of the best things about visiting Haikou is how easy it is to travel to nearby cities in Hainan or even to mainland China. Whether you want to explore tropical beaches or visit larger cities, you have a few good options by train, bus, or ferry.

🚄 Haikou to Sanya

Wuzhizhou Island

Sanya is a famous beach city in the south of Hainan Island. It is a popular weekend destination with beautiful beaches, resorts, and seafood.

  • By high-speed train: About 1.5 to 2 hours from Haikou East Railway Station
  • Trains run often from early morning until evening
  • Tip: Book a window seat to enjoy the scenic views along the coast

🚌 Haikou to Wenchang

Shitou (Boulder) Park

Wenchang is a smaller city northeast of Haikou known for its Hainanese chicken rice and space launch center.

  • By train: About 30 to 40 minutes
  • By bus or car: Around 1 to 1.5 hours
  • Tip: Try the local-style chicken rice in the city center for a food trip

🛳️ Haikou to Mainland China (via ferry or train)

Badaling Great Wall

You can also travel from Haikou to mainland cities like Guangzhou or Zhanjiang. These trips usually take longer but offer a unique travel experience.

  • By ferry to Guangdong: Some ferries connect Haikou’s ports to cities like Zhanjiang
  • By train: Haikou Railway Station also has trains that cross the Qiongzhou Strait using a rail ferry
  • Travel time: Usually 8 to 12 hours, depending on the destination
  • Tip: Overnight trains are more convenient if you want to save on hotel costs

📱 Useful Transport Apps in Haikou

To make getting around easier, download these apps before arriving:

1. Didi

DiDi

Best for taxis and private rides. Easy to use in English and ideal if you don’t speak Chinese.

2. Baidu Maps or Amap (Gaode)

Baidu Maps

Baidu Maps

Amap (Gaode Map)

Amap (Gaode)


More accurate than Google Maps in China. Useful for bus routes, walking directions, and travel time estimates.

3. Alipay (Transport QR)

Alipay

Lets you pay for buses and some transport services without cash. Very convenient for daily travel.

📌 Tip: Set up mobile payment before your trip, as many transport services prefer cashless payment.

Many drivers and transport services prefer mobile payment. Set up Alipay or WeChat Pay in advance if possible.
